OpenWrt DHCPv6 flaw puts routers on urgent patch watch

OpenWrt CVE-2026-53921 is a critical DHCPv6 overflow in odhcpd that could let reachable requests run code as root. Update to 24.10.8 or 25.12.5 and keep router services limited to trusted networks.
